Description
This tender is for the supply and implementation of a safeguarding software system that will protect pupils in schools in Coventry from on-line dangers. The system must support schools in meeting their safeguarding duties in ensuring that appropriate filters and monitoring is in place to ensure that children cannot access harmful or inappropriate materials whilst on-line. It must also ensure that children are protected from the risk of radicalisation under the Prevent Duty
The duration of the contract will be for an initial period of three years with the option to extend for seven further 1 year periods at the agreement of both parties. The contract will commence on or as close as possible to 1st April 2017.
